If you’re craving a dish that embodies the rich, bold flavors of traditional Mexican cuisine, look no further than these carnitas enchiladas. This recipe combines tender, slow-cooked pork carnitas with savory enchilada sauce, wrapped in soft corn tortillas and baked to perfection.
The result is a comforting, flavorful meal that bursts with layers of texture and spice, perfect for family dinners or entertaining guests. Whether you’re a seasoned cook or a kitchen novice, these enchiladas offer a fantastic way to enjoy authentic Mexican flavors with a twist.
What makes this recipe truly special is the harmony between the crispy edges of the enchiladas and the juicy, flavorful pork inside. The homemade carnitas bring a smoky, melt-in-your-mouth quality that elevates the dish beyond your average enchiladas.
Plus, the recipe is versatile enough to customize with your favorite toppings and sides. Get ready to impress your taste buds and your dinner guests with these irresistible carnitas enchiladas!
Why You’ll Love This Recipe
This recipe is a celebration of textures and flavors. The carnitas are slow-cooked until tender and then slightly crisped for that perfect bite.
Combined with a rich, homemade enchilada sauce and melty cheese, these enchiladas offer a comforting yet exciting meal that’s easy to prepare.
Because the pork is cooked ahead of time, assembling these enchiladas is quick and hassle-free. They’re also incredibly adaptable—swap out the pork for chicken or beef if you prefer, or add black beans and corn for a vegetarian twist.
Plus, these enchiladas reheat wonderfully, making them perfect for leftovers or meal prep.
Ingredients
- 2 pounds pork shoulder, cut into large chunks
- 1 tablespoon olive oil
- 1 large onion, quartered
- 4 cloves garlic, minced
- 1 teaspoon ground cumin
- 1 teaspoon dried oregano
- 1/2 teaspoon chili powder
- Salt and pepper to taste
- 2 cups enchilada sauce (store-bought or homemade)
- 12 corn tortillas
- 2 cups shredded Mexican cheese blend
- 1/4 cup fresh cilantro, chopped
- Optional toppings: sliced avocado, sour cream, diced onions, lime wedges
Equipment
- Slow cooker or large heavy pot for cooking carnitas
- Large skillet for warming tortillas
- Baking dish (9×13 inch recommended)
- Mixing bowls
- Sharp knife and cutting board
- Measuring spoons and cups
Instructions
- Prepare the carnitas: In a slow cooker or large pot, add pork shoulder, olive oil, onion, garlic, cumin, oregano, chili powder, salt, and pepper. Add enough water or broth to cover the pork halfway. Cook on low for 6-8 hours or until pork is tender and easily shredded.
- Shred the pork: Remove pork from the pot and shred with two forks. Discard large pieces of fat and any bones. Return shredded pork to the pot with a small amount of cooking liquid to keep it moist.
- Preheat your oven: Set to 375°F (190°C).
- Warm the tortillas: Heat a skillet over medium heat. Quickly warm each tortilla for about 10 seconds per side until soft and pliable. This prevents them from breaking when rolling.
- Assemble the enchiladas: Pour 1 cup of enchilada sauce on the bottom of the baking dish. Fill each tortilla with a generous spoonful of shredded pork and a sprinkle of cheese. Roll up each tortilla and place seam-side down in the dish.
- Top with sauce and cheese: Pour the remaining enchilada sauce over the rolled tortillas. Sprinkle the remaining shredded cheese evenly on top.
- Bake: Place the baking dish in the oven and bake for 20-25 minutes, or until the cheese is melted and bubbly.
- Garnish and serve: Remove from oven and sprinkle with fresh cilantro. Add optional toppings such as sliced avocado, sour cream, diced onions, and lime wedges for extra flavor.
Tips & Variations
For extra crispy carnitas edges, spread the shredded pork on a baking sheet and broil for 5 minutes before assembling the enchiladas.
You can make your own enchilada sauce using dried chiles and spices if you prefer a more authentic flavor. Feel free to add black beans, corn, or diced jalapeños inside the enchiladas for added texture and heat.
For a creamy twist, mix some cream cheese or sour cream into the filling before rolling. To make this dish vegetarian, substitute the pork with sautéed mushrooms and beans.
Nutrition Facts
| Nutrient | Amount per serving |
|---|---|
| Calories | 450 kcal |
| Protein | 30 g |
| Fat | 22 g |
| Carbohydrates | 28 g |
| Fiber | 4 g |
| Sodium | 600 mg |
Serving Suggestions
Serve your carnitas enchiladas with a side of Mexican rice or refried beans for a complete meal. A fresh green salad with a zesty lime dressing pairs beautifully to balance the richness of the pork and cheese.
Complement the meal with traditional sides like guacamole, pico de gallo, or pickled jalapeños. A cold cerveza or a refreshing agua fresca makes a perfect beverage pairing.
Conclusion
Carnitas enchiladas are a delicious way to bring the heart of Mexican comfort food to your table. With tender, flavorful pork and a rich enchilada sauce, this recipe is sure to become a family favorite.
The best part is that you can customize it to suit your taste, whether you like it spicy, cheesy, or loaded with fresh toppings.
Making carnitas from scratch may seem intimidating, but the slow-cooker method simplifies the process and rewards you with melt-in-your-mouth pork. This dish is perfect for weeknight dinners or special occasions, and leftovers taste incredible reheated.
Give this recipe a try and enjoy a vibrant, satisfying meal that everyone will love!
📖 Recipe Card: Carnitas Enchiladas
Description: Delicious enchiladas filled with tender, flavorful carnitas and topped with a rich enchilada sauce and melted cheese. Perfect for a hearty and satisfying meal.
Prep Time: PT20M
Cook Time: PT40M
Total Time: PT60M
Servings: 6 servings
Ingredients
- 2 cups cooked carnitas
- 12 corn tortillas
- 2 cups red enchilada sauce
- 1 1/2 cups shredded Monterey Jack cheese
- 1/2 cup diced onions
- 1/4 cup chopped fresh cilantro
- 1/2 cup sour cream
- 1 tablespoon vegetable oil
- 1 teaspoon ground cumin
- 1/2 teaspoon garlic powder
- Salt and pepper to taste
- 1 lime, cut into wedges (optional)
Instructions
- Preheat oven to 375°F (190°C).
- Heat vegetable oil in a skillet and lightly fry tortillas until soft, then drain on paper towels.
- Mix carnitas with cumin, garlic powder, salt, and pepper.
- Dip each tortilla in enchilada sauce, fill with carnitas and onions, then roll tightly.
- Place rolled enchiladas seam side down in a baking dish.
- Pour remaining enchilada sauce over the top and sprinkle with cheese.
- Bake for 20-25 minutes until cheese is melted and bubbly.
- Garnish with cilantro and serve with sour cream and lime wedges.
Nutrition: Calories: 420 kcal | Protein: 28 g | Fat: 18 g | Carbs: 35 g
{“@context”: “https://schema.org/”, “@type”: “Recipe”, “name”: “Carnitas Enchiladas”, “image”: [], “author”: {“@type”: “Organization”, “name”: “GluttonLv”}, “description”: “Delicious enchiladas filled with tender, flavorful carnitas and topped with a rich enchilada sauce and melted cheese. Perfect for a hearty and satisfying meal.”, “prepTime”: “PT20M”, “cookTime”: “PT40M”, “totalTime”: “PT60M”, “recipeYield”: “6 servings”, “recipeIngredient”: [“2 cups cooked carnitas”, “12 corn tortillas”, “2 cups red enchilada sauce”, “1 1/2 cups shredded Monterey Jack cheese”, “1/2 cup diced onions”, “1/4 cup chopped fresh cilantro”, “1/2 cup sour cream”, “1 tablespoon vegetable oil”, “1 teaspoon ground cumin”, “1/2 teaspoon garlic powder”, “Salt and pepper to taste”, “1 lime, cut into wedges (optional)”], “recipeInstructions”: [{“@type”: “HowToStep”, “text”: “Preheat oven to 375\u00b0F (190\u00b0C).”}, {“@type”: “HowToStep”, “text”: “Heat vegetable oil in a skillet and lightly fry tortillas until soft, then drain on paper towels.”}, {“@type”: “HowToStep”, “text”: “Mix carnitas with cumin, garlic powder, salt, and pepper.”}, {“@type”: “HowToStep”, “text”: “Dip each tortilla in enchilada sauce, fill with carnitas and onions, then roll tightly.”}, {“@type”: “HowToStep”, “text”: “Place rolled enchiladas seam side down in a baking dish.”}, {“@type”: “HowToStep”, “text”: “Pour remaining enchilada sauce over the top and sprinkle with cheese.”}, {“@type”: “HowToStep”, “text”: “Bake for 20-25 minutes until cheese is melted and bubbly.”}, {“@type”: “HowToStep”, “text”: “Garnish with cilantro and serve with sour cream and lime wedges.”}], “nutrition”: {“calories”: “420 kcal”, “proteinContent”: “28 g”, “fatContent”: “18 g”, “carbohydrateContent”: “35 g”}}